Akshaya Tritiya, 2008

Akshaya Tritiya is one of the most sacred and widely celebrated festivals of Hindus. It falls on the third day(Tritiya) of the bright half moon of the Vaisakha month(April-May). For 2008, the day falls on 7th May, Wednesday.
According to Hindu Puranas, the day marks the beginning of Treta Yug; the birthday of Parasurama- the sixth incarnation of Lord Vishnu and Lord Vishnu is worshipped on this day. Goddess Lakshmi also worshipped on this day. At Puri Jagannath temple Candanotsavam is performed for Lord Jagannath.
This day is considered as one among the four most sacred and golden days of a year and Hindus consider this day as an auspicious day to start new ventures, business, purchases, investing, gruha pravesham and marriages etc. Mostly people buy and wear gold on this day which is the ultimate symbol of wealth, prosperity and fortune. According to Hindu astrology, every moment of this day is auspicious and there is no need to look for a muhurat on the day to start new ventures.
The word ‘Akshaya’ means imperishable and eternal prosperity- that which never diminishes, so new ventures made and valuables purchased on this day would be fruitful and believed to bring luck and success.
Significance of Akshaya Tritiya Festival
One can realize the background meaning of a festival or any occasion in Indian culture that ultimately aims at the betterment of humanity, if he/she goes deep into it. In the same way Akshaya Tritiya has its own deepest meaning and truth. It is also believed that by performing good deeds on this day, one can earn Punya for life.
It has been a ritual since years that people do some good deeds on this day such as donating food in temples, forgiving and forgetting the past to renew relationships, resolving to leave bad habits and practicing good habits in life etc. This is the actual significance behind celebrating this festival beside other scientific, religious, astrological significances which ultimately works for the betterment of an individual as well as a society.

Akshaya Tritiya, variously spelt as Akshya Thiritiya, Akshaya Trutheeya, Akshaya Tritiiya and also called Akshaya Trithi, falling on the third day of the bright half of the lunar month of Vaisakha of the traditional Hindu calendar, is one of the four most auspicious days of the year for Hindus. The word Akshaya, a Sanskrit word, literally means one that never diminishes, and the day is believed to bring good luck and success. It is widely celebrated in all parts of India by different sections of the society irrespective of their religious faith and social grouping. The day is particularly considered auspicious for buying long term assets like gold and silver, including ornaments made of the same; diamond and other precious stones; and the real estate. The legend states that any venture initiated on the auspicious day of Akshaya Tritiya shall continue to grow and bring prosperity. Hence, it is normal to see many of the new ventures, like starting a business, ground breaking for construction etc on the Akshaya Tritiya Day.
With the mass media and marketing, this day has been taken over by marketeers to promote sales and bookings for Gold jewellery, houses, consumer electronics.
The day is also traditionally celebrated as the birth day of the Hindu sage Parashurama, the sixth avatar (incarnation) of the God Vishnu.
